About this Bible story

Samson's story is one of strength and redemption. In Judges 16:28, he calls out, 'O Sovereign LORD, remember me.' His final act is powerful, reminding us of his complex journey and reliance on God despite his flaws.

β€œO Sovereign LORD, remember me.”

β€” Judges 16:28 (NIV)
